What are the different standards for Rail Elastic Clips?
Elastic rail clip standards vary by manufacturer and country, often categorized by type, such as E-clips, SKL clips, and others, and by application (e.g., high-speed, heavy-haul). International standards like EN 13481 and UIC are frequently referenced for performance, while national standards like AREMA (American Railway Engineering and Maintenance-of-Way Association) and others exist to meet specific regional requirements.

Common standards and classifications
By type:
- E-type clips: Used in systems like the E-clip fastening system, commonly found in America, India, and other countries.
- SKL clips: A popular type in Germany and used in other regions.
- Fast clip systems: Newer systems that represent a trend in fastener technology, used in high-speed lines in Europe, Japan, and North America.
- Other types: Include PR clips, Nabla clips, Deenik clips, and specialized crane rail clips.

| Model | Diameter | Weight | Material |
| Type III | Ø18 | 0.80k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| E1609 | Ø16 | 0.43 k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| E1809 | Ø20 | 0.61k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| E1813 | Ø18 | 0.62k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| E2001 | Ø20 | 0.80k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| E2007 | Ø20 | 0.80k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| E2009 | Ø20 | 0.80k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| E2039 | Ø20 | 0.80k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| E2055 | Ø20 | 0.80k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| E2056 | Ø20 | 0.80k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| E2063 | Ø20 | 0.80k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| PR85 Rail Clip | Ø13 | 0.25k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| PR309A | Ø19 | 0.85k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| PR401 | Ø20 | 0.97k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| PR415 | Ø20 | 0.95k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| PR601A | Ø20 | 1.03kg/pc | 38Si7 |
| SKL 1 | Ø13 | 0.48kg/pc | 60Si2CrA |
| SKL 3 | Ø13 | 0.48kg/pc | 60Si2CrA |
| SKL 12 | Ø13 | 0.53kg/pc | 38Si7 |
| SKL 14 | Ø13 | 0.53k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| Special Rail Clip | Ø13 | 0.48k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| Russia Rail Clip | Ø18 | 0.58k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|
| Deenik Clip | Ø25 | 0.49-0.68kg/pc | 60Si2MnA |

By international and national standards:
- EN 13481: A European standard for railway fastening systems.
- UIC (International Union of Railways): Standards that are often adopted internationally.
- AREMA: The American standard for railway fasteners.
- ISO: International Organization for Standardization standards.
- GB/T and TB/T: Chinese national standards.

By application:
- Standards are developed based on the specific application, such as those for passenger dedicated lines or ballasted tracks with shoulderless concrete sleepers.
- Requirements also differ for different types of track, including high-speed, heavy-haul, and conventional lines.
